ADHD Diagnosis for Adults in the UK: A Comprehensive Guide
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is typically viewed as a childhood condition; however, lots of adults also grapple with its signs, which can significantly impact their personal and professional lives. In the United Kingdom, acquiring a proper diagnosis as an adult can sometimes be a complex journey. This article intends to light up the process of ADHD diagnosis for adults within the private health care sector in the UK.

Comprehending ADHD in Adults
ADHD is defined by a relentless pattern of inattention and/or hyperactivity-impulsivity. While the signs of ADHD are frequently identified in youth, numerous adults stay undiagnosed, leading to distress and obstacles in numerous domains of life, consisting of work, relationships, and social settings.
Typical signs in adults may include:
- Disorganization and problems focusing on jobs.
- Trouble sustaining attention in jobs or activities.
- Impulsivity and difficulty with self-discipline.
- Issues with time management and meeting deadlines.
- Chronic monotony and restlessness.

The Diagnosis Process in Private Clinics
1. Preliminary Consultation
The journey typically starts with setting up a preliminary consultation with a private clinic that focuses on ADHD. Throughout this consultation, the clinician will collect details relating to the individual’s signs, medical history, and any relevant family history.
2. Comprehensive Assessment
Following the preliminary assessment, a thorough assessment is normally conducted. This might include:
- Clinical Interviews: In-depth conversations that provide insights into the individual’s behavioral patterns and obstacles.
- Standardized Questionnaires: Tools like the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) or other confirmed assessments that assist evaluate the seriousness and effect of symptoms.
- Collateral Information: Gathering information from member of the family or considerable others, when proper, can supply extra context to the clinician.
3. Diagnostic Criteria
Clinicians use diagnostic requirements outlined in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) to make a diagnosis. The requirements need that signs need to exist in numerous settings (e.g., work, home) and must interfere with social, scholastic, or occupational functioning.
4. Feedback Session
As soon as the assessment is complete, a feedback session is scheduled, where clinicians share their findings and talk about the diagnosis, treatment alternatives, and potential methods for management.
5. Treatment Planning
If detected with ADHD, a personalized treatment strategy can be established, which might consist of a combination of medication, psychotherapy, training, and way of life changes.
Private vs. NHS Diagnosis
While numerous adults in the UK go with private clinics for faster access to diagnosis and treatment, it’s crucial to comprehend the differences:
| Factor | Private Diagnosis | NHS Diagnosis |
|---|---|---|
| Waiting Time | Normally quicker admissions | Often has longer waiting lists |
| Cost | High, differed by clinic | Free at the point of access |
| Assessment Style | More customized method | Structured, might be less individual |
| Follow-Up | Flexible and regular | May be limited due to resources |
Frequently Asked Questions About ADHD Diagnosis for Adults in the UK
1. How much does a private ADHD assessment cost in the UK?
The cost of a private ADHD assessment can vary from ₤ 300 to over ₤ 1,000, depending upon the clinic and the comprehensiveness of the assessment.
2. For how long does the diagnosis process take?
The procedure may vary widely. A preliminary consultation can often be arranged within a couple of weeks, while the complete assessment and diagnosis can take a number of weeks to months depending on the clinic’s processes.
3. Are there treatment choices available when diagnosed?
Yes, treatment alternatives can include medication, c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), training, and lifestyle modifications, customized to the person’s needs.
4. What qualifications should I search for in a clinician?
Seek out clinicians who are certified mental health specialists with particular experience in detecting and treating ADHD in adults. This might consist of psychiatrists, psychologists, or specialized nurse professionals.
5. Can ADHD be detected later in life, even if signs existed in youth?
Yes, adults who were not diagnosed as children can still receive a valid diagnosis in later life if they exhibit consistent symptoms that meet the diagnostic requirements.
